L’illa de Paidonèsia

The Island of Paidonesia

Oriol Canosa

"An epistolary structure makes this clever novel flow, as children construct a world where they’re the ones in charge."

A nine-year-old boy is traveling by boat with his parents. He gets so bored that he decides to disembark on an island and start his own, new country. From there he sends out a letter to the children of the world to join him in his cause.

Once he has a group gathered, they found the country based on letters that they send out to important grownups around the world and their replies. More and more kids join him on the island, and more and more complications arise. As in the work of Roald Dahl, the author is firmly on the side of the children.
